What is Under-Eye Rejuvenation?

Under-eye rejuvenation is a set of treatments that help improve the look of the skin under your eyes. Many people notice dark circles, puffiness, or fine lines in this area. These changes can make you look tired or older. Because the skin here is thin, it often shows signs of stress or aging first. In obstetrics and gynecology, hormonal changes during pregnancy or menopause can also affect this area. For this reason, many women seek safe cosmetic procedures to refresh their under-eye area.

Common Causes of Under-Eye Concerns

There are several reasons why the under-eye area may look tired or puffy. Some causes are temporary, while others may need treatment for dark circles or to reduce eye bags. Common causes include:

  • Lack of sleep or poor sleep quality
  • Hormonal changes, especially during pregnancy or menopause
  • Allergies or sinus problems
  • Genetics or family history
  • Dehydration or poor diet
  • Sun exposure without protection
  • Natural aging, which thins the skin
  • However, some medical conditions can also cause under-eye changes. Always talk to your doctor if you notice sudden or severe symptoms.

    Symptoms and When to Seek Help

    Most under-eye concerns are not serious. Still, it is important to know when to get help. Common symptoms include:

  • Dark circles or shadows under the eyes
  • Puffiness or swelling (eye bags)
  • Fine lines or wrinkles
  • Redness or irritation
  • Sometimes, these symptoms can signal a health issue. For example, if you have sudden swelling, pain, or vision changes, seek medical advice right away. Additionally, if home remedies do not help, a specialist can suggest safe cosmetic procedures.

    Diagnosis and Assessment

    First, your doctor will ask about your symptoms and medical history. They may also check for allergies or other health problems. In some cases, blood tests or skin exams help find the cause. For women, doctors may ask about pregnancy, periods, or menopause. This is because hormonal changes can affect the skin under your eyes. After the assessment, your doctor will suggest the best treatment for dark circles or ways to reduce eye bags.

    Popular Treatment Options

    There are many ways to treat under-eye concerns. Some treatments are simple and can be done at home. Others may need a visit to a clinic. Popular options include:

  • Cold compresses to reduce swelling
  • Moisturizers with vitamin C or retinol
  • Allergy medicines if allergies are a cause
  • Laser therapy or chemical peels (done by a specialist)
  • Fillers or injections for deeper lines (safe when done by experts)
  • Microneedling to boost collagen
  • In addition, always choose clinics with trained staff. If you live in a city, you may have more options for safe cosmetic procedures. However, always check the clinic’s reputation and safety standards.

    Lifestyle Tips for Prevention

    While some causes are out of your control, many steps can help prevent under-eye problems. Try these tips:

  • Get enough sleep each night
  • Drink plenty of water
  • Eat a balanced diet rich in fruits and vegetables
  • Use sunscreen and wear sunglasses outdoors
  • Manage allergies with your doctor’s help
  • Avoid rubbing your eyes
  • Remove makeup gently before bed
  • Moreover, regular self-care can keep your skin looking fresh and healthy.

    Frequently Asked Questions

  • Can pregnancy cause dark circles?
  • Yes, hormonal changes during pregnancy can lead to dark circles or puffiness.
  • Are under-eye treatments safe during pregnancy?
  • Some treatments are safe, but always check with your obstetrician before starting any procedure.
  • How long do results from under-eye rejuvenation last?
  • It depends on the treatment. Some results last a few months, while others can last longer with good care.
  • Can I prevent under-eye bags as I age?
  • While aging is natural, healthy habits and sun protection can help reduce eye bags and dark circles.
